Abstract

This research is rooted in the important role of Education for Sustainable Development (ESD), particularly given preliminary findings indicating that ESD its less than optimal integration into the Junior High School science curricula. The purpose of this research was to develop and evaluate student responses to Augmented Reality (AR) as an ESD-based learning material, focusing on the theme of Biodiversity Sustainability for junior high students. The methodology employed is Research and Development (R&D), utilizing the ADDIE model and specifically concentrating on the development phase. The process of developing the AR learning material involved a series of systematic stages, analyzing potential and problems, data collection, product design, validation, product revision, and assessing student responses. Data collection instruments included interviews, observations, validation sheets, and student response questionnaires. The validity test results indicated that the developed product achieved a 92% score, categorizing it as highly valid. Furthermore, the questionnaire's reliability level registered a value of 0.715, deemed reliable. Student responses to the use of this product were overwhelmingly positive, reaching 94.38%. These findings collectively demonstrate that the development of AR as an ESD-themed Biodiversity Sustainability learning material is considered valid and effective for student use.

Additional Information: Penelitian ini didasari oleh pentingnya Education for Sustainable Development (ESD) dalam pendidikan, terutama karena hasil pra-penelitian menunjukkan bahwa integrasi ESD pada materi pelajaran IPA di tingkat SMP ditemukan belum optimal. Melalui kondisi tersebut, penelitian ini bertujuan untuk mengembangkan dan menguji respon siswa terhadap Augmented Reality (AR) sebagai bahan ajar berbasis ESD dengan tema Keberlanjutan Biodiversitas untuk siswa SMP. Metode yang diterapkan adalah penelitian pengembangan (Research and Development) dengan model ADDIE, yang difokuskan hingga tahap development. Proses pengembangan AR sebagai bahan ajar melibatkan serangkaian tahapan sistematis, meliputi analisis potensi dan masalah, pengumpulan data, perancangan produk, validasi, revisi produk serta hasil respon siwa. Instrumen pengumpulan data yang digunakan diantaranya wawancara, observasi, lembar validasi, dan angket respons siswa. Hasil uji validitas menunjukkan bahwa produk memperoleh 92% yang masuk dalam kategori sangat valid. Di samping itu, tingkat keandalan angket mencatat nilai sebesar 0,715, yang tergolong reliabel. Hasil respon siswa terhadap pemanfaatan produk ini mencapai 94,38%. Temuan ini menunjukkan bahwa pengembangan AR sebagai bahan ajar dengan tema ESD Keberlanjutan Biodiversitas dianggap valid dan efektif sebagai bahan ajar yang dapat digunakan siswa.
